Lafayette Parish Daily Arrest Report

One of the best features of the Lafayette Parish Sheriff's Office is the daily arrest report. This is published at lafayettesheriff.com/daily-arrest-report/ and shows detailed information about each arrest made in the parish. You can also subscribe to get these reports sent to your email each day.

Lafayette Parish daily arrest report page for booking reports

The daily arrest report shown above includes the name, age, arrest date and time, address or block, charges, arresting agency, cause for arrest, any property seized, and the incident number. This is much more detail than most parishes provide online. It gives you a full picture of each booking that happened that day in Lafayette Parish.

The report covers arrests by the sheriff's office and other agencies that operate in the parish. Each entry is a public record under RS 44:1. The daily format makes it easy to track booking activity over time. If you missed a day, you can go back and check older reports on the site.

Lafayette Parish Community Portal

The Lafayette Parish Sheriff's Office uses a 365Labs Community Portal to show current inmates and recently booked offenders. You can access it at the 365Labs Community Portal. This portal replaced the old JADES jail management system. It shows everyone currently housed in LPCC plus anyone booked in the last 72 hours.

Lafayette Parish community portal showing inmates and booking reports

The community portal shown above lets you browse through current inmates and recently booked individuals in Lafayette Parish. This is a real-time look at who is in custody and who was brought in over the past three days.

The sheriff's office posts a disclaimer with this data. It says the information is offered in the interest of public safety and for use by law enforcement. Any unauthorized use is forbidden and subject to criminal prosecution. Nothing on the site should be taken to imply guilt or wrongdoing of anyone listed. This is standard language for jail roster systems in Louisiana, and it does not limit your right to view the booking data under Code of Criminal Procedure Article 228.

How to Find Lafayette Parish Booking Reports

Lafayette Parish gives you three main ways to find booking reports. The daily arrest report page is best for recent arrests. The community portal shows who is currently in LPCC. And calling the office at (337) 232-9211 works for older records or more specific requests.

For the online tools, you do not need to create an account. Just go to the site and search. The daily arrest report is organized by date. The community portal lets you browse by name. Both are free. If you need copies of official booking records, you can request them from the sheriff's office or email corrections@lafayettesheriff.com. The LAVNS VineLink system is also an option if someone has been moved to state custody.

Note: The 365Labs portal shows bookings from the last 72 hours, so check it within three days of an arrest for the best results.

What Lafayette Parish Booking Reports Show

Lafayette Parish booking reports are some of the most detailed in the state. The daily arrest report alone shows more data than many parishes provide at all. Under RS 44:3, booking records are specifically public records, even while other law enforcement investigation files may be sealed.

Lafayette Parish booking reports typically include:

  • Full name and age
  • Arrest date and time
  • Charges and statute numbers
  • Arresting agency
  • Bond information
  • Incident number
  • Property seized if applicable

The community portal adds current housing information for people still in LPCC. This gives you a more complete view of the person's status in the Lafayette Parish system. Between the daily report and the portal, you get both the arrest details and the current custody status in one parish.

Lafayette Parish Records Under Louisiana Law

Louisiana law gives you the right to see Lafayette Parish booking reports. The Public Records Act under RS 44:1 says all records used in public business are open. RS 44:3 names booking records specifically as public. Code of Criminal Procedure Article 228 says booking information must always be open for inspection.

Comprehensive criminal history is handled differently. The Louisiana State Police maintains the LACCH system under RS 15:587. Louisiana is a closed record state for that data. Only authorized agencies can access it. A state background check costs $31. But that is a separate system from booking reports. The booking data you see on the Lafayette Parish Sheriff's site is free and open to everyone.
